From 073af428efc21d7717c003e93a098d0767de3b0c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Peter Korsgaard Date: Wed, 30 Dec 2009 13:42:01 +0100 Subject: Makefile.autotools.in: fix libtool patching Fixes two issues with libtool patching: - It seems like the default value for _LIBTOOL_PATCH only gets set AFTER the ifdef check, so the conditional was never taken. Fix it by instead checking that it isn't explicitly set to not do the patching instead. - The $i in the libtool patching for loop needed an extra level of escaping to work.
